Excellent Goffs Orby Sale for Minzaal
Plenty of Shadwell-sired yearling upcoming at Tattersalls
Minzaal’s first-crop yearlings continue to be well received by the market, with all 11 of his representatives at Goffs Orby Book 1 this week changing hands for an average of €117,273 and median of €110,000.
The top price of €300,000 was paid by Joe Murphy’s Crampscastle Bloodstock for a half-sister to Group 3 winner One For Bobby out of the Listed-winning mare One Spirit, offered by The Castlebridge Consignment.
Other six-figure lots by Minzaal at the auction were bought by Legion Bloodstock, Amo Racing, Rabbah Bloodstock, Jason Kelly, Peter and Ross Doyle Bloodstock and Jamie McCalmont.
Minzaal maintained momentum in Goffs Orby Book 2, with another 100% clearance rate for all of his seven lots finding new homes. A top price of €80,000 was paid by renowned breeze-up consignor Willie Browne for a filly out of a half-sister to 1,000 Guineas runner-up Lucida.
Browne said of his purchase: “We saw her several times over the last couple of days and she’s the standout filly here. She’s a lovely walker and is very well put together. Her sire Minzaal was a fast horse and hopefully he’ll pass on that speed. From what I’ve seen of the sire's yearlings they’re sharp and look like they’ll be early two-year-olds.”
Minzaal has already sired the top lot at the Goffs UK Premier Yearling Sale in Doncaster, a filly out of the Listed-winning Footstepsinthesand mare Hateya who sold to Shadwell for £190,000, as well as a colt out of the well-bred Tamayuz mare Oriental Step who made £135,000 at the same auction.
Those results have been achieved off a €15,000 opening fee at Derrinstown.
Minzaal has six lots on offer at Book 1 of the Tattersalls October Yearling Sale next week, and 29 in Book 2 and six in Book 3 the week after that.
Brilliant European champion and fellow Shadwell sire Baaeed’s first yearlings were also in strong demand at Goffs Orby, selling for €240,000, €125,000 and €100,000.
There are sure to be fireworks when 20 more of his debut lots are presented at Tattersalls October Book 1.
